Advanced Exercises to Strengthen your Knee Muscles.

If you have knee pain then here are some advanced exercises you can do to further strengthen your muscles.

They are designed to improve movement, strengthen your muscles and ease pain and discomfort too.

We see a lot of people in our clinics who have reached the age of 40 and their knees are starting to let them down and they are struggling to take part in the activities they enjoy.

 

Please be aware of your body and take advice from your GP before exercising if you have any aches or pain, or send us an email (enquiries@physio-logical.net) for advice and guidance. All of these exercises should be pain free.

Alongside exercises we can offer hands on treatment to improve joint movement and release tight muscles. Hands on physiotherapy treatments including; sports massage, mobilisation, taping, balance (proprioceptive) re-education, combined with stretching and strengthening exercises is an effective treatment for knee pain.
